Building integrated photovoltaics
1 of 20 from Photos: Solar Decathlon, start your houses
The afternoon sun hits the solar-cell covered front wall of the University of Kentucky's solar-powered home. It's one of 20 houses put up up on the National Mall that are competing in the Solar Decathlon, a Department of Energy-run event to showcase the potential of solar energy and energy-efficiency in buildings. If you can't make it to Washington before October 13, these photos will give you a taste of the architecture and technology used inside and outside these net zero-energy homes.
